WikiLeaks' Assange expected to plead guilty to US espionage charge: Document
Monday, June 24th 2024, 11:30:32 pm
article
WikiLeaks founder Julian Assange is expected to plead guilty this week to violating U.S. espionage law, in a deal that could end his imprisonment in Britain and allow him to return home to Australia, U.S. prosecutors said.
